KUALA LUMPUR: Sime Darby Plantation (SDP) will reimburse its current and former foreign workers recruitment fees totalling RM82.02 million on Feb 17, following the company’s comprehensive audits both internally and by independent organisations.
According to a statement today, the group said it will reimburse 15,078 current foreign workers an aggregate sum of RM38.55 million.
